本摘要介绍了负载均衡优化方案,涵盖全方位解析和高效策略。通过实践应用,提升系统性能和稳定性,实现资源合理分配,保障业务流畅运行。
本文目录导读:
随着互联网的飞速发展,企业业务规模不断扩大,系统架构日益复杂,如何保证系统的高可用性、高性能和稳定性成为企业关注的焦点,负载均衡作为保证系统稳定运行的关键技术,发挥着至关重要的作用,本文将针对负载均衡优化方案进行详细解析,旨在帮助企业提高系统性能,降低运维成本。
负载均衡优化方案
1、资源分配优化
(1)合理配置硬件资源:根据业务需求,合理分配CPU、内存、硬盘等硬件资源,确保负载均衡器具备足够的处理能力。
图片来源于网络,如有侵权联系删除
(2)采用高效的网络设备:选用高性能、低延迟的网络设备,提高数据传输速度,降低网络拥堵。
(3)优化负载均衡器配置:根据业务特点,调整负载均衡器的工作模式、会话保持时间、健康检查策略等,实现高效资源分配。
2、算法优化
(1)轮询算法:按照请求顺序将请求分发到各个服务器,适用于服务器性能差异不大的场景。
(2)最少连接数算法:根据服务器当前连接数,选择连接数最少的服务器进行分发,适用于高并发场景。
(3)IP哈希算法:根据客户端IP地址进行哈希分发,保证同一客户端的请求总是分发到同一服务器,适用于需要会话保持的场景。
(4)响应时间算法:根据服务器响应时间进行分发,将请求分配给响应时间较短的服务器,提高系统整体性能。
3、会话保持优化
图片来源于网络,如有侵权联系删除
(1)静态会话保持:通过在负载均衡器上设置会话保持规则,确保同一客户端的请求总是分发到同一服务器。
(2)动态会话保持:通过在服务器上设置会话保持机制,如Cookie、Session等,保证用户在访问过程中始终连接到同一服务器。
4、健康检查优化
(1)增加健康检查项:针对业务特点,增加相应的健康检查项,如HTTP状态码、数据库连接数等,确保服务器状态实时监控。
(2)设置健康检查阈值:根据业务需求,设置健康检查阈值,当服务器性能低于阈值时,自动将其从负载均衡池中移除。
(3)优化健康检查策略:根据服务器性能波动情况,调整健康检查频率,提高健康检查的准确性。
5、安全优化
(1)设置访问控制:限制非法IP访问,防止恶意攻击。
图片来源于网络,如有侵权联系删除
(2)SSL/TLS加密:对传输数据进行加密,保障数据安全。
(3)防止DDoS攻击:采用防火墙、WAF等技术,抵御DDoS攻击。
实践应用
1、在线教育平台:采用负载均衡技术,实现海量用户同时在线学习,保证系统稳定运行。
2、电商平台:通过负载均衡技术,提高订单处理能力,确保购物体验。
3、金融行业:采用负载均衡技术,实现高并发交易处理,保障资金安全。
4、游戏平台:通过负载均衡技术,实现游戏服务器负载均衡,降低玩家卡顿现象。
负载均衡优化是企业提高系统性能、降低运维成本的关键技术,通过资源分配优化、算法优化、会话保持优化、健康检查优化和安全优化,可以有效提高负载均衡器的性能和稳定性,企业应根据自身业务特点,选择合适的负载均衡优化方案,实现系统的高效运行。
评论列表